Agra: Five individuals including a woman died and one person was critically injured when a truck collided with an auto in Agra on Saturday. The accident occurred on Delhi-Agra Highway this evening. The truck driver is on the run since the accident.

According to reports, the accident happened near Gurudwara Guru Ka Taal crossing in Agra at 4.00 pm. The incident lead to a huge traffic jam as crowd gathered at the accident site.

Speaking to media agency ANI, DCP Suraj Kumar Rai said, “We received information that a truck and auto have collided on the National Highway. 5 people have died in the incident and one person is injured…Situation is under control at the spot. Necessary legal action will be taken in the matter.”

After receiving information about the incident, police reached the spot, seized the bodies and sent them for autopsy. The injured was rushed to the nearby hospital. The cops have also initiated a probe into the matter.
